Ping - Dies ist ein Dienstprogramm, mit dem Sie die Verfügbarkeit eines Knotens (eines Computers oder Servers) im Internet überprüfen und die Verzögerung der Datenübertragung zu diesem Knoten bewerten können. Der Name "Ping" leitet sich von dem Ton ab, der ein Signal erzeugt, das gesendet wird, um die Verfügbarkeit des Knotens zu überprüfen. Eine Antwort vom Host kann auf den Status der Netzwerkverbindung hinweisen und mögliche Kommunikationsprobleme identifizieren.
Wenn Sie Ping verwenden, wird eine Kommunikation mit dem Knoten hergestellt und ein Signal (ein Datenpaket) gesendet, auf das der Knoten antworten soll. Die Zeit, die ein Paket benötigt, um vom Absender zum Empfänger und zurück zu wechseln, wird als ping. Normalerweise wird die Zeit in Millisekunden gemessen, und ein niedrigerer Ping zeigt eine bessere Verbindungsgeschwindigkeit an.
Ping kann in verschiedenen Situationen nützlich sein. Es hilft Ihnen zu bestimmen, wie schnell eine Verbindung zu einem Computer oder Server hergestellt wird, und die Qualität der Netzwerkverbindung zu bewerten. Wenn der Ping sehr hoch ist oder Fehler bei der Datenübertragung auftreten, kann dies auf Netzwerkprobleme oder eine falsche Konfiguration der Knoten hinweisen.
Mithilfe von Ping können Sie mögliche Probleme im Netzwerk schnell erkennen und beheben sowie die Verbindungsqualität und Verfügbarkeit von Websites im Internet überwachen.
Ping: Arbeitsmerkmale und Bedeutung
Um einen Ping zu senden, müssen Sie die IP-Adresse oder den Domänennamen des Hosts kennen, zu dem Sie die Verfügbarkeit überprüfen möchten. Sie senden dann ein spezielles Datenpaket (ICMP Echo Request) an den angegebenen Knoten. Beim Empfang dieses Pakets sendet der Knoten das Datenpaket (ICMP Echo Reply) zurück und berechnet dann die Zeit, in der die Daten in beide Richtungen übertragen wurden.
Die grundlegende Bedeutung von Ping besteht darin, dass Sie die Reaktionszeit des Netzwerks und die Verbindungsstabilität bestimmen können. Eine niedrigere Pingzeit weist normalerweise auf eine schnellere und stabilere Verbindung hin, während eine höhere Zeit auf Netzwerkprobleme oder Störgeräusche hinweisen kann. Ping kann auch verwendet werden, um das Latenzniveau im Netzwerk zu bestimmen, was bei einigen Aufgaben wie Online-Spielen oder VoIP-Verbindungen wichtig sein kann.
Ping kann auch verwendet werden, um das Routing im Netzwerk zu bestimmen. Sie können an die Adresse des Knotens pingen und sehen, welche Knoten das Datenpaket durchläuft, bevor der Zielknoten erreicht wird. Dies kann nützlich sein, um Netzwerkprobleme zu diagnostizieren oder den optimalen Pfad für die Datenübertragung zu bestimmen.
Es ist wichtig zu beachten, dass Ping keine vollständige Verfügbarkeit von Knoten oder Verbindungsstabilität garantiert. Es kann vorkommen, dass der Host möglicherweise nicht zum Ping verfügbar ist, z. B. aufgrund von Firewall-Einstellungen oder ICMP-Blockierung von Anforderungen. Außerdem kann die Pingzeit aufgrund von Netzwerkauslastung oder Bandbreitenproblemen verlängert werden.
Daher sollte die Verwendung von Ping als eines der Tools zur Diagnose und Bestimmung des Netzwerkstatus angesehen werden, jedoch nicht als einziger Indikator für den Betrieb und die Verfügbarkeit von Knoten.
Die Bedeutung des Begriffs Ping in einem Computernetzwerk
Wenn der Ping-Befehl ausgeführt wird, werden die Netzwerkpakete an die angegebene IP-Adresse oder den angegebenen Domänennamen gesendet. Als Antwort sendet der Kommunikationsknoten, an den das Paket gesendet wurde, ein Antwortpaket. Die für diesen Vorgang benötigte Zeit wird gemessen und dem Benutzer als Antwortzeit (Ping time) angezeigt.
Die wichtigsten Ping-Parameter sind:
- Ping-Zeit (Ping-Zeit) - Die Zeit in Millisekunden, die zum Senden von Daten vom Absender zum Empfänger und zurück erforderlich ist. Je niedriger dieser Wert ist, desto besser ist die Verbindung.
- Paketverlust (packet loss) - Der Prozentsatz der Pakete, die während der Übertragung verloren gehen. Bei einem hohen Paketverlust kann es zu Problemen mit der Netzwerkverbindung oder der Netzwerkauslastung kommen.
- Durchschnittliche Pingzeit (average ping time) - Die durchschnittliche Antwortzeit für einen bestimmten Zeitraum.
Ping wird für verschiedene Zwecke verwendet:
- Überprüfen der Hostverfügbarkeit - Mit einem Ping können Sie feststellen, ob ein Remotecomputer oder ein Server verfügbar ist.
- Verbindungsgeschwindigkeitserkennung - Ping ermöglicht die Messung der Reaktionszeit, was bei der Bewertung der Stabilität und Geschwindigkeit einer Netzwerkverbindung nützlich sein kann.
- Routenablaufverfolgung - Der Befehl Ping kann auch verwendet werden, um die Route zu bestimmen, die Pakete durchlaufen, wenn Daten zwischen zwei Kommunikationsknoten übertragen werden.
Es ist wichtig zu beachten, dass Ping kein ideales Werkzeug für die Netzwerkdiagnose ist, da einige Kommunikationsknoten die zum Senden des Ping verwendeten ICMP-Pakete blockieren oder aussortieren können. Darüber hinaus kann die Reaktionszeit durch verschiedene Faktoren beeinflusst werden, z. B. durch die Netzwerklast oder durch Probleme mit Kommunikationsgeräten.
Abschließend ist Ping ein wichtiges Werkzeug für die Diagnose einer Netzwerkverbindung. Es hilft Ihnen, die Verfügbarkeit von Kommunikationsknoten zu ermitteln, die Verbindungsgeschwindigkeit und -stabilität zu messen und die Übertragungsroute zu bestimmen. Für eine vollständige Netzwerkdiagnose sind jedoch möglicherweise andere Tools und Methoden erforderlich.
Das Prinzip des Ping-Vorgangs
Wenn ein Datenpaket mit einem Ping-Befehl gesendet wird, wird es durch das Netzwerk zum angegebenen Knoten geleitet. In diesem Prozess wird ein kleines Datenpaket gesendet, das Informationen zur Sendezeit enthält. Wenn der entfernte Knoten verfügbar ist, empfängt er das Paket und sendet es zurück. Die Zeit, die ein Paket benötigt, um hin und her zu gehen, wird RTT (Round-Trip Time) genannt.
Wenn Sie das Paket zurück erhalten, berechnet ping die Durchlauf- und Reaktionszeit des Knotens. Anhand der empfangenen Daten können Sie feststellen, wie stabil die Kommunikation mit einem entfernten Knoten ist. Wenn die Pakete den Remotehost nicht erreichen oder die Antwort zu lange dauert, kann dies auf Netzwerkprobleme oder Probleme mit dem Remotehost hinweisen.
Mit Ping können Sie auch die Lebensdauer eines Pakets (TTL) bestimmen, die angibt, wie viele Zwischenknoten im Netzwerk ein Paket durchlaufen kann, bevor es verworfen wird. Wenn die TTL des Pakets abläuft, erreicht es den entfernten Knoten nicht und kommt mit einer Fehlermeldung zurück.
Ping ist ein einfaches und gebräuchliches Werkzeug, um die Verfügbarkeit von Knoten im Netzwerk zu überprüfen und die Reaktionszeit zu messen. Es wird häufig von Netzwerkadministratoren verwendet, um Probleme im Netzwerk zu überwachen und zu diagnostizieren sowie die Kommunikationsgeschwindigkeit zu testen.
Praktische Anwendung von Ping
Hier sind einige praktische Beispiele für die Verwendung von Ping:
- Überprüfen der Hostverfügbarkeit: ping kann verwendet werden, um zu überprüfen, ob ein bestimmter Host im Netzwerk verfügbar ist. Wenn beim Ping eine erfolgreiche Paketantwort empfangen wird, bedeutet dies, dass der Host verfügbar ist.
- Identifizieren von Netzwerkverbindungsproblemen: ping kann helfen festzustellen, ob Probleme mit der Netzwerkverbindung auftreten. Wenn die Pakete nicht erfolgreich übertragen werden oder die Reaktionszeit zu lang ist, kann dies auf Verbindungsprobleme oder einen Ausfall der Netzwerkhardware hinweisen.
- Erkennen von Netzwerkverzögerungen: ping kann verwendet werden, um Verzögerungen zwischen Geräten im Netzwerk zu erkennen. Wenn die Reaktionszeit hoch ist, kann dies auf Bandbreitenprobleme oder einen Engpass in der Netzwerkinfrastruktur hinweisen.
- Testen der Internetverbindung: ping kann verwendet werden, um die Internetverbindung zu überprüfen. Wenn Hosts im Internet erfolgreich auf Ping reagieren, zeigt dies an, dass eine Internetverbindung besteht.
- Verfolgen des Pfads zum Remote-Host: der Ping kann zusammen mit dem Dienstprogramm "Traceroute" verwendet werden, um den Pfad zu finden, den Pakete vom Absender zum Empfänger führen. Dies kann helfen, problematische Knoten auf der Route oder unzugängliche Knoten zu identifizieren.
Im Allgemeinen ist Ping ein nützliches Werkzeug, um Netzwerkprobleme zu diagnostizieren, die Verfügbarkeit von Geräten zu überprüfen und Netzwerklatenz zu ermitteln. Es wird häufig in der Systemadministration, im Netzwerk-Engineering verwendet und kann auch für normale Benutzer nützlich sein, um den Netzwerkstatus oder die Internetverbindung zu überprüfen.